BEMIDJI — The
Bemidji Public Library,
in collaboration with the Beltrami County Master Gardeners, is set to host a “Container Vegetable Gardening” event at 10 a.m. on Saturday, April 19, at the library, 509 America Ave.
Master Gardener Dan Sherman will teach participants gardening tips, including selecting seed, soil and containers, dates to start, lighting and heating, disease prevention and preparing for transplanting, a release said.
Sherman has been gardening since he was 12 years old and continues to share his experience with gardening in the area.
